MANDUKA Announces First-Ever ‘Made for Yoga’ Apparel Line

MANDUKA Announces First-Ever ‘Made for Yoga’ Apparel Line. Manduka, creators of high performance yoga gear and the #1 choice of yoga teachers worldwide, revealed today that it will launch its first collection of men’s and women’s apparel designed for the practice on the mat, and in life.

Built on the values of the brand’s legendary Black PRO Mat, the ‘Made for Yoga’ activewear line was created with the highest standards in sustainability and brings innovative styles and features that support the body in motion. The line will be available through www.manduka.com, yoga studios and select national retailers starting in February 2016.

“Nearly two decades ago, Manduka launched with one mat that revolutionized the way teachers and students practice yoga,” said Sky Meltzer, CEO Manduka. “Our belief in the transformational power of the yoga practice is prevalent in our first, beloved black mat and has carried through our entire collection of yoga gear and now apparel. With this launch we take an important step forward in enhancing the experience of yoga on and off the mat.”

Inspired by yoga teachers, athletes and the principles of nature – the men’s and women’s apparel collection is soulfully engineered by yogis, featuring the most cutting edge design technology available in athletic wear and sustainable fabrications. Made from recycled polyester, organic cotton, hemp, Tencel & Modal and Sorona, each material is intentionally chosen for the practice of yoga, allowing for maximum comfort, fit and movement.

“The greatest innovation in athletic apparel today is the advancement of sustainability,” said Joanne Sessler, VP Product & Design. “The Manduka apparel collection is both intuitively and technically designed for the body in motion. We are featuring fabrics and enhancements that elevate the practice, from breathability to the right amount of stretch, allowing the body to fully reach its potential in yoga, without being hindered by unnecessary features. All of our material choices are inspired by the practice of yoga with sustainability at the forefront.”

The first ever Manduka women’s collection features a full line of performance and lifestyle apparel including pants, bras, camisoles and après yoga pieces specifically constructed to provide support and comfort during yoga practice. The colors are inspired by natural environments, from the high desert hues of spring, to the mid summer brilliance of the ocean’s water and coast. The styles are contemporary, express individuality and simplicity of design.

Manduka’s first men’s collection answers much needed demand in the fast growing men’s yoga community, unifying the familiar designs style of old school athletics with the comfort and function of surf inspired apparel. The tees, shorts, tanks, pants and hoodies are constructed to resolve reoccurring challenges and discomforts in athletic apparel worn on the mat, while maintaining the lifestyle appeal of street wear. Its color story is inspired by the way your favorite, ‘never to part with’ tees and shorts look at the end of summer, worn in and washed out by the sun.

Manduka’s distinctly ‘Made for Yoga’ line is the beginning of a new era in yoga apparel, presenting the marriage of high function and high purpose on the mat. The complete Spring Summer 2016 collection will launch to the yoga community and national retailers on February 2016 with 40 unique styles and multiple drop shipments throughout the year.
